IOWA<br />
God has opened the door in Iowa this year. A student leader<br />
named Trent wanted to stand for Christ, and when he heard about<br />
<strong>Decision</strong> <strong>Point</strong> he started getting coaching right away. With only a<br />
few months before graduation, Trent launched a club and hosted<br />
an outreach event where over 200 students came and 7 students<br />
indicated first-time decisions to follow Christ. Our goal is to see<br />
over 10 schools coached this next year, and for the Lord to appoint<br />
a full-time staff candidate. By the grace of God, we have our first<br />
Iowa-based intern starting this fall for a gap year with us.<br />
OHIO<br />
Our team has been working in Ohio for the last three<br />
years and as of March this year, Luke Peters joined<br />
our team full time. He was an answer to prayer as<br />
we know the harvest is plentiful, but the laborers are<br />
few! Luke helped a student named Kenzie lead an<br />
outreach at Wadsworth High School and she said that<br />
it was the biggest event they’ve ever had with over 75<br />
students in one day!<br />
INDIANA<br />
A former Student Leader from Wheaton North High<br />
School named Alli Beck has been working part time<br />
with <strong>Decision</strong> <strong>Point</strong> in Indiana, breaking ground in that<br />
state. She was able to coach two schools near Taylor<br />
University and equip students to share the gospel.<br />
This year one youth group went out with Alli to the<br />
local mall to share Christ and many of them said that<br />
it was one of the most incredible experiences of their<br />
faith journey!<br />
MINNESOTA<br />
As we’ve been exploring opportunities in Minnesota,<br />
our team was able to equip several dozen youth<br />
pastors with tools to reach their schools. This all<br />
culminated in speaking at Districts Blitz, a youth<br />
conference where 2,800 students gathered in Duluth,<br />
MN. There we ran a workshop with nearly 200 students<br />
in attendance and one youth pastor told us “I’ve been<br />
looking for a way to reach the schools in Duluth for<br />
years… this is an answer to prayer!”<br />
